在现代社会,油罐作为储存和运输石油及其产品的关键设施,其安全性和效率至关重要。从油罐泄漏风险的管理到节能优化,Matlab作为一款强大的数学计算和仿真软件,在其中发挥着不可替代的作用。本文将深入探讨Matlab在油罐仿真中的应用,从风险分析到节能优化,一一道来。
油罐泄漏风险分析
1. 泄漏模型建立
油罐泄漏风险分析是确保油罐安全运行的第一步。Matlab提供了丰富的工具箱,如Simulink,可以用来建立油罐泄漏的物理模型。
代码示例:
% 模拟油罐泄漏过程
model = Simulink('LeakageSimulation');
open_system(model);
2. 泄漏概率评估
通过模拟油罐在不同条件下的泄漏情况,Matlab可以计算不同泄漏事件的概率。
代码示例:
% 评估不同泄漏事件的概率
leakageProbabilities = sim(model, 'LeakageProbabilities');
disp(leakageProbabilities);
3. 风险缓解措施
基于泄漏概率分析,Matlab可以帮助设计有效的风险缓解措施,如增加安全阀、改进密封系统等。
代码示例:
% 设计风险缓解措施
riskMitigationMeasures = designRiskMitigation(model);
disp(riskMitigationMeasures);
节能优化
1. 热力学分析
Matlab的热力学工具箱可以用于分析油罐的热能损失,从而找出节能的潜在点。
代码示例:
% 分析油罐热能损失
heatLossAnalysis = thermalAnalysis(model);
disp(heatLossAnalysis);
2. 能耗优化策略
通过模拟不同的操作策略,Matlab可以帮助优化油罐的能耗,提高运行效率。
代码示例:
% 优化油罐能耗
energyOptimizationStrategy = optimizeEnergy(model);
disp(energyOptimizationStrategy);
3. 经济效益评估
Matlab还可以评估节能措施的经济效益,帮助决策者做出合理的选择。
代码示例:
% 评估节能措施的经济效益
economicBenefits = evaluateEconomicBenefits(model);
disp(economicBenefits);
总结
Matlab在油罐仿真中的应用广泛,从风险分析到节能优化,都能提供强大的支持。通过Matlab的仿真工具,可以更直观地了解油罐的运行状态,从而提高油罐的安全性和效率。在未来的发展中,Matlab将继续在油罐仿真领域发挥重要作用。
